Delbert Dean Larsen was born March 26, 1937, to Floyd Cleland Larsen and Margaret Caroline (Knudsen) Larsen. He married Judy Elaine (Havekost) Larsen in December 1957. They have three children and
five grandchildren, a daughter, Julie Larsen, and her husband Chris Vogt from Irvine California, a daughter Pam Rasmussen and her husband Dale, from Ceresco, Nebraska, and a son Todd Larsen and his wife
Anjana from Temecula California. The grandchildren are Kallie Larsen, Loki and Tanner Rasmussen, and Tyler and Troy Larsen. He is also survived by his brother Lyman Larsen and wife Mary of Omaha.

Del graduated from Hooper High School in 1955. He attended the University of Nebraska at Lincoln and was a walk-on for the football team. He was in the Army for two years and worked for Fremont Farmer's Union Coop, and First National Bank of Hooper. He farmed for 30 years and retired in 1999.

Delbert was a member of Grace Lutheran Church, which became Redeemer Lutheran Church. He was on the council at Redeemer. He was on the Board of Directors at the First National Bank of Hooper. Delbert was
president of the Fremont Shrine Club, Master of the Masonic Lodge of Hooper, and Worthy Patron of Friendship Chapter #122. He was also a member of the Hooper Volunteer Fire Department. He was president of the Board at Elkhorn Valley Golf Course and a member of the Oakland Golf Course Board. He was also a member of the American Legion Post 18 of Hooper. Del gave of his time and talents in volunteer activities.
